Plugins built against Quillbase components v4 are failing on staging because the env file pins the v3 registry channel. Fix: set `QUILLBASE_CHANNEL=stable-4` and rebuild. The v4 registry also requires an access token in the same file. Append the registry token directly below this line.

vault entry, kagep-yajeg: COURIER_KEY5=da097

Ticket: Per-tenant rate quotas drifted again (Hivelock API). Prod quotas for three tenants don't match what's in the quota manifest — looks like support bumped them manually during the onboarding crunch and nobody backfilled the repo. Future maintainers: please treat the manifest as the source of truth and revert or codify these. For the record, the live values right now are the following.

service settings:
[silwyn]
host = silwyn.crelvogrid.internal
user = silwyn_svc
database = silwyn_prod

Subject: Partner SFTP drop — new owner

Hi,

As you review the pending changes to the Harborline ingest scripts, note that ownership of the partner SFTP drop is changing at the end of the month. This includes key rotation, the nightly pull job, and the quarantine folder for malformed files. Review comments on the retry logic should still go through the normal PR flow, but questions about drop-folder conventions or partner onboarding now go to the new owner. The incoming owner is listed below.

signatory, tagaf-bahaf: Praael Fenmir Rusok

Handover note — Crumbwheel order cutoffs.

Welcome aboard. The bakery cutoff rule in Crumbwheel closes same-day orders at 14:00 local to each storefront, not UTC — this has bitten us twice. Holiday overrides live in the calendar service and take precedence silently, so always check there first when a cutoff looks wrong. To unlock the calendar service's admin console after a restart, enter the recovery passphrase below.

vault phrase of bagap-bahaf = silion-pelox-sorox-casdor-quenwyn-fraax-eliox-praael-kelion-quenvan-kasox-rusael-norius-belvan